
The screenplay of Ozu's The Only Son made in 1936 is translated here into English for the first time. The Only Son is supposed to be his first talkie. It depicts the character of an ideal mother in the traditional Japanese society. The present work contains the full Japanese texts of the two screenplays transliterated into the Roman alphabet. These translations are based on the texts of the screenplays in Ozu Yasujiro Sakuhin-shu III (A Collection of Ozu Yasujiro's Works- III published in 1984 by Rippu Shobo in Tokyo).
